An Act relative to reducing the use of toxic pesticides in the town of Eastham

Notwithstanding chapter 132B of the General Laws or any other general or special law to the contrary, the town of Eastham may regulate through by-law the use of toxic pesticides within the town.
This act shall take effect upon its passage.
